Huijsen will miss Sunday’s match against Getafe

Real Madrid defender Dean Huijsen will be forced to miss Real Madrid’s next game against Getafe —Sunday, 21:00 CEST— with the muscle injury which forced him to leave Spain’s training camp during this ongoing FIFA break.

The team’s coaching staff will try to make sure that he’s ready to face both Juventus and Barcelona immediately after the match in Getafe and there’s optimism around the club about his availability for both games, according to a report from The Athletic.

Huijsen is an undisputed starter for Xabi Alonso, so rushing him back would make no sense if that increases the risk of him missing the crucial El Clásico against Barcelona. In his absence, Raúl Asencio and Eder Militao will likely be the ones starting in the center of Real Madrid’s defensive line, although Aurelien Tchouameni could also play in that spot if Xabi Alonso wants to give Eduardo Camavinga a chance to start as a defensive midfielder.
